Talyena Trueheart
08-15-2002, 04:08 AM
There are two changes you have to make with the animations file. The one that has TextureInfo item = "window_pieces04.tga" which follows and identical section for pieces03. It was on line 88 or so of the animations file. And then there is the actual compass art part at the end of the file. You also need to add the new window_pieces04.tga file to your custom folder.

Cormath
08-16-2002, 11:15 AM
If the compass is not working with your mods it is because the "window_pieces04.tga" file needs to be removed from your mod.

The way the UI now works, only the mods you need should be in your alternate folder. Anything not in your alternate custom folder will be used from your default folder. This will allow the patcher to update the default files while leaving your customs intact.

The original "window_pieces04.tga" file is a duplicate of some of the color boxes in a different file. If you delete it from your custom folder, the compass will work again (UI will use the one in the default folder).
